Official system requirements for PC

To run Lifeless Planet, you'll need at least 1.5 GB of RAM and 900 MB of free disk space. The game requires a minimum graphics card like the GeForce GT 430, but for a better experience, the developers recommend using an GeForce GT 640. As for your CPU, an Core 2 Duo E4300 is the minimum, but if you want to crank up the settings and enjoy smoother gameplay, aim for an Core i3-530 or better.
